Output df26e2886a6b33d49b9e2b1232ca39c982ebfdca8fdce1edeaa585ef672ee5a6:3

value
157951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afff50c334a721f54267bf5b62244e5d1c06e96 OP_EQUAL
address
3EMyoEcoEeyYh6PCBx9NNgqhSbUfWbpL52
transaction
df26e2886a6b33d49b9e2b1232ca39c982ebfdca8fdce1edeaa585ef672ee5a6
confirmations
61003
spent
true